Что такое алгоритмы и как они применяются в передовых решениях
Алгоритмы представляют собой ряд чётко заданных команд для решения специфической проблемы. Каждый алгоритм содержит первоначальные данные и планируемый исход. Нынешние технологии применяют алгоритмы на каждом уровне функционирования цифровых комплексов.
Программные утилиты складываются из множества алгоритмов, которые анализируют сведения и производят разнообразные операции. Смартфоны используют алгоритмы для идентификации лиц и улучшения работы батареи. Интернет-сервисы используют казино без депозита для индивидуализации материала.
Поисковые системы применяют сложные алгоритмы для упорядочивания веб-страниц и предоставления уместных итогов. Социальные сети применяют алгоритмы для составления информационной потока каждого пользователя.
Финансовые компании используют алгоритмы для исследования угроз и определения fraudulent платежей. Транспортные системы используют казино для оптимизации направлений и контроля трафиком.
Совершенствование разработок привело к созданию алгоритмов машинного обучения и искусственного разума. Эти алгоритмы исследуют модели и формируют прогнозирования на фундаменте огромных массивов сведений.
Определение алгоритма и его ключевые характеристики
Алгоритм является ясным представлением ряда операций, направленных на получение определённого результата. Математики и программисты создали строгое толкование алгоритма как завершённого совокупности законов, применимых к стартовым информации.
Любой алгоритм имеет комплектом ключевых свойств, которые выделяют его от обычной директивы:
- Дискретность подразумевает разбиение процесса на обособленные первичные стадии
- Определённость предполагает однозначного понимания каждого шага
- Результативность обеспечивает получение итога за конечное число действий
- Массовость позволяет использовать алгоритм к целому типу заданий
Детерминированные алгоритмы постоянно генерируют идентичный результат при при и тех же стартовых данных. Стохастические алгоритмы задействуют казино онлайн для обретения результата с заданной степенью достоверности.
Производительность алгоритма оценивается по длительности выполнения и величине используемой памяти. Идеальные алгоритмы разрешают проблему с минимальными издержками процессорных ресурсов.
Роль алгоритмов в обыденной виртуальной реальности
Сегодняшний человек каждодневно работает с десятками алгоритмов, часто не ощущая их присутствия. Утренний будильник на смартфоне применяет алгоритмы для мониторинга циклов сна и подбора наилучшего момента подъёма. Навигационные приложения применяют алгоритмы для вычисления пути с учётом транспортной обстановки.
Мобильные банковские программы задействуют казино без депозита для обработки выплат и контроля защищённости операций. Камеры смартфонов задействуют алгоритмы для повышения уровня изображений. Речевые ассистенты идентифицируют голос благодаря комплексным алгоритмам анализа аудио.
Онлайн-магазины применяют алгоритмы для отбора изделий на базе хроники просмотров. Музыкальные службы формируют личные списки, рассматривая предпочтения аудитории. Видеоплатформы рекомендуют содержимое с помощью алгоритмов, анализирующих действия пользователей.
Умные жилища применяют алгоритмы для роботизации иллюминации и теплоснабжения. Фитнес-трекеры считают шаги и калории с содействием анализа сведений с сенсоров. Алгоритмы превратились обязательной компонентом ежедневной действительности.
Алгоритмы в поисковых системах и советующих службах
Поисковые системы выполняют миллиарды обращений постоянно, используя комплексные алгоритмы сортировки результатов. Эти алгоритмы исследуют содержимое веб-страниц, их релевантность запросу и достоверность ресурса. Поисковые системы используют казино онлайн для определения максимально подходящих данных.
Алгоритмы упорядочивания принимают множество факторов при построении результатов:
- Совпадение материала поисковому обращению пользователя
- Качество и уникальность письменного контента страницы
- Число и уровень ссылок, направляющих на страницу
- Скорость открытия и удобство применения ресурса
Рекомендательные системы задействуют алгоритмы совместной фильтрации для определения интересов. Содержательные алгоритмы анализируют параметры товаров для селекции схожих альтернатив. Комбинированные системы комбинируют несколько подходов для увеличения точности предложений.
Алгоритмы компьютерного обучения беспрерывно улучшают уровень нахождения. Системы изучают активность участников и время изучения для улучшения итогов.
Применение алгоритмов в социальных сетях
Социальные сети применяют алгоритмы для создания персонализированной потока новостей каждого пользователя. Платформы исследуют контакты с материалом, чтобы отображать максимально занимательные публикации. Алгоритмы оценивают лайки, комментарии и продолжительность ознакомления для установления релевантности материала.
Алгоритмы социальных сетей применяют казино без депозита для ранжирования публикаций знакомых и сообществ. Системы учитывают свежесть материала и известность публициста. Видеоматериал зачастую получает преимущество в списке благодаря алгоритмам популяризации.
Маркетинговые алгоритмы подбирают нужную аудиторию на базе интересов и активности пользователей. Платформы используют алгоритмы для борьбы с запрещённым материалом и спамом. Системы модерации самостоятельно обнаруживают несоблюдения правил группы.
Алгоритмы советуют свежих друзей и привлекательные сообщества на базе имеющихся контактов. Социальные сети применяют казино для изучения схемы социальных соединений и установления взаимных увлечений. Платформы регулярно обновляют алгоритмы для оптимизации пользовательского опыта.
Алгоритмы в финансовых технологиях и онлайн-платежах
Финансовые компании используют алгоритмы для выполнения миллионов транзакций постоянно. Банковские системы задействуют алгоритмы кодирования для обеспечения секретных сведений клиентов. Платёжные службы контролируют законность транзакций с помощью казино онлайн исследования поведенческих паттернов.
Алгоритмы обнаружения fraud рассматривают каждую транзакцию в формате актуального времени. Системы учитывают расположение, сумму платежа и запись транзакций. Подозрительные транзакции останавливаются самостоятельно для избежания финансовых убытков.
Кредитный скоринг применяет алгоритмы для определения финансовой надёжности должников. Системы анализируют заёмную историю и финансовые показатели. Алгоритмы помогают банкам принимать решения о предоставлении кредитов быстрее.
Торговые алгоритмы на площадках совершают операции за части мгновения. Быстрая купля-продажа использует алгоритмы для анализа биржевых информации. Криптовалютные платформы применяют казино онлайн для осуществления децентрализованных платежей. Алгоритмы улучшают взносы и скорость выполнения транзакций.
Применение алгоритмов в досуговых платформах
Видеостриминговые платформы задействуют алгоритмы для персонализации рекомендаций контента. Платформы исследуют историю обзоров и рейтинги кинолент для отбора соответствующих материалов. Алгоритмы рассматривают жанровые вкусы и известность содержимого среди похожих юзеров.
Музыкальные приложения применяют алгоритмы для создания самостоятельных списков на базе настроения слушателя. Системы рассматривают скорость треков и жанры для формирования согласованных подборок. Алгоритмы радио используют казино без депозита для отбора схожих песен и обнаружения свежих музыкантов.
Игровые платформы используют алгоритмы для отбора противников с подобным степенью навыка. Системы матчмейкинга гарантируют равноценные команды и интересные игровые матчи. Алгоритмы формирования содержимого генерируют уникальные этапы в играх.
Подкаст-приложения применяют алгоритмы для совета серий по интересам юзера. Сервисы электронных книг используют для рекомендации текстов аналогичных стилей. Алгоритмы гибкого стриминга подстраивают качество видео под быстроту сетевого подключения.
Алгоритмы защищённости и обеспечения сведений
Криптографические алгоритмы обеспечивают секретность передачи данных в сети. Системы криптования трансформируют информацию в нечитаемый формат для охраны от неразрешённого входа. Алгоритмы двухключевого криптования задействуют набор кодов для безопасного пересылки посланиями.
Алгоритмы хеширования генерируют уникальные числовые отпечатки данных и паролей. Системы хранят хеши паролей вместо оригинальных значений для улучшения безопасности. Алгоритмы проверяют целостность информации и обнаруживают правки в данных.
Антивирусные приложения применяют алгоритмы образцового изучения для выявления распознанных рисков. Системы поведенческого анализа задействуют для определения новых категорий опасного программного ПО.
Системы двухэтапной проверки используют алгоритмы создания временных паролей для защиты учётных аккаунтов. Биометрические алгоритмы идентифицируют узоры пальцев и лица. Межсетевые фильтры применяют для отбора интернет движения и остановки сомнительных связей.
Автоматизированное обучение и искусственный разум на базе алгоритмов
Алгоритмы машинного обучения обеспечивают компьютерным структурам обучаться на информации без непосредственного программирования. Нейронные сети применяют многослойные алгоритмы для распознавания образов и принятия вердиктов. Системы глубокого обучения применяют казино для анализа фото, текста и аудио.
Алгоритмы тренировки с супервизором работают с размеченными информацией для классификации и предвидения. Системы учатся на образцах с знакомыми верными результатами. Алгоритмы обучения без супервизора выявляют латентные паттерны в сведениях.
Алгоритмы переработки обычного наречия позволяют системам понимать человеческую говор. Системы автоматизированного перевода задействуют нейронные сети для трансформации надписи между языками. Чат-боты используют алгоритмы для ведения разговоров с участниками.
Машинное зрение использует алгоритмы для определения элементов на картинках. Беспилотные транспортные машины применяют казино онлайн для маршрутизации на пути. Медицинские системы задействуют алгоритмы для диагностики патологий по изображениям.
Эффект алгоритмов на пользовательский восприятие
Алгоритмы определяют электронный впечатление миллиардов юзеров постоянно. Персонализация материала превращает общение с сервисами более простым и соответствующим. Системы подстраиваются под индивидуальные вкусы, экономя продолжительность на отыскание информации.
Алгоритмы оптимизации интерфейсов совершенствуют навигацию и упрощают выполнение задач. Системы A/B проверки задействуют казино для выбора максимально эффективных версий интерфейса. Гибкие алгоритмы подстраивают вывод содержимого под размер монитора аппарата.
Предиктивные алгоритмы прогнозируют действия юзеров и советуют соответствующие советы. Автозаполнение полей и рекомендации запросов ускоряют контакт с платформами. Алгоритмы сохранения гарантируют быструю открытие постоянно применяемых информации.
Однако избыточная настройка формирует сведений коконы, ограничивая разнообразие контента. Участники получают исключительно содержимое, подходящие их существующим мнениям. Алгоритмы могут усиливать предубеждённость и шаблоны. Открытость работы алгоритмов превращается важным условием для построения доверия к электронным сервисам.
